Record grading guide

Every record is graded visually (and play-tested when in doubt) using the Goldmine standard — the same scale used by Discogs sellers worldwide. Media and sleeve are always graded separately.

MMint — perfect, usually still sealed. We use this grade very rarely.
NMNear Mint — looks barely played. No visible marks, plays clean.
VG+Very Good Plus — light signs of use, minor sleeve wear. Plays great; our most common grade.
VGVery Good — visible wear, may have light surface noise that doesn't overpower the music.
G+ / GGood — plays through without skipping but with noticeable noise. Priced accordingly.
F / PFair / Poor — filler or collector copies only. Always described in the notes.

Anything worth mentioning that the grade doesn't capture is in the seller notes on each listing.
